📄 shorten.mid
字号:
l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) sll $5,$5,16 lbu $4,2($3) sll $2,$2,24 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$5,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$5,$2 .set noreorder .set nomacro bne $2,$0,$L217 move $7,$9 .set macro .set reorder move $3,$5 move $4,$0$L219: andi $2,$3,0xff00 .set noreorder .set nomacro beq $2,$0,$L783 addiu $2,$15,%lo(ff_log2_tab) .set macro .set reorder srl $3,$3,8 addiu $4,$4,8$L783: addu $2,$3,$2 lbu $3,0($2) addu $8,$4,$3 slt $2,$8,21 .set noreorder .set nomacro beq $2,$0,$L222 li $3,30 # 0x1e .set macro .set reorder .set noreorder .set nomacro bltz $5,$L735 move $8,$0 .set macro .set reorder$L227: addiu $7,$7,1 sra $3,$7,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$7,0x7 sll $4,$4,$3 .set noreorder .set nomacro bgez $4,$L227 addiu $8,$8,1 .set macro .set reorder li $5,2147418112 # 0x7fff0000 ori $2,$5,0xfffd slt $2,$2,$8 sll $4,$4,1 .set noreorder .set nomacro beq $2,$0,$L736 addiu $3,$7,1 .set macro .set reorder ori $2,$5,0xfffe .set noreorder .set nomacro beq $8,$2,$L235 addiu $16,$4,1 .set macro .set reorder li $16,-1 # 0xffffffffffffffff$L226: lw $2,16500($18) .set noreorder .set nomacro bne $2,$0,$L737 li $6,2147418112 # 0x7fff0000 .set macro .set reorder li $17,2147418112 # 0x7fff0000$L778: move $5,$2 move $4,$20 ori $6,$17,0xffff .set noreorder .set nomacro jal get_ur_golomb_jpegls move $7,$0 .set macro .set reorder lw $3,16500($18) .set noreorder .set nomacro bne $3,$0,$L240 sw $2,16512($18) .set macro .set reorder li $2,1 # 0x1 li $6,2147418112 # 0x7fff0000$L777: move $5,$2 ori $6,$6,0xffff move $4,$20 .set noreorder .set nomacro jal get_ur_golomb_jpegls move $7,$0 .set macro .set reorder .set noreorder .set nomacro blez $2,$L738 move $3,$2 .set macro .set reorder lw $2,8($20) sll $3,$3,3 addu $9,$3,$2 li $3,3 # 0x3 slt $2,$16,3 movz $3,$16,$2 sw $9,8($20)$L197: sw $3,16520($18) .set noreorder .set nomacro jal allocate_buffers move $4,$18 .set macro .set reorder .set noreorder .set nomacro bne $2,$0,$L245 li $5,1 # 0x1 .set macro .set reorder lw $2,16512($18) lw $6,16516($18) slt $3,$0,$2 li $4,3 # 0x3 .set noreorder .set nomacro beq $6,$4,$L248 movn $5,$2,$3 .set macro .set reorder li $2,5 # 0x5 .set noreorder .set nomacro beq $6,$2,$L248 lui $6,%hi($LC13) .set macro .set reorder lw $4,0($18) addiu $6,$6,%lo($LC13) .set noreorder .set nomacro jal av_log move $5,$0 .set macro .set reorder jal abort$L724: lw $4,96($18) .set noreorder .set nomacro jal memmove addu $5,$4,$7 .set macro .set reorder lw $6,100($18) move $7,$0 .set noreorder .set nomacro j $L159 sw $0,104($18) .set macro .set reorder$L321: li $2,2 # 0x2 subu $3,$3,$5 addiu $4,$5,-2 subu $2,$2,$5 addiu $5,$9,32 srl $4,$6,$4 sll $3,$3,2 addu $9,$2,$5 addu $8,$4,$3 sw $9,8($20)$L325: sltu $2,$8,10 .set noreorder .set nomacro beq $2,$0,$L333 move $7,$8 .set macro .set reorder lui $2,%hi($L339) sll $7,$8,2 addiu $2,$2,%lo($L339) addu $2,$7,$2 lw $3,0($2) j $3 .rdata .align 2 .align 2$L339: .word $L334 .word $L334 .word $L334 .word $L334 .word $L335 .word $L336 .word $L337 .word $L334 .word $L334 .word $L338 .section .text.shorten_decode_frame$L316: .set noreorder .set nomacro j $L318 li $4,16 # 0x10 .set macro .set reorder$L728: sll $5,$7,2$L330: srl $2,$4,30 addiu $9,$3,2 addu $8,$5,$2 .set noreorder .set nomacro j $L325 sw $9,8($20) .set macro .set reorder$L198: lw $9,8($20) lw $10,0($20) s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$6,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$6,$2 .set noreorder .set nomacro bne $2,$0,$L201 move $7,$9 .set macro .set reorder move $3,$6 move $4,$0$L203: andi $2,$3,0xff00 .set noreorder .set nomacro beq $2,$0,$L784 lui $15,%hi(ff_log2_tab) .set macro .set reorder srl $3,$3,8 addiu $4,$4,8$L784: addiu $2,$15,%lo(ff_log2_tab) addu $2,$3,$2 lbu $3,0($2) addu $5,$4,$3 slt $2,$5,21 .set noreorder .set nomacro beq $2,$0,$L206 li $3,30 # 0x1e .set macro .set reorder .set noreorder .set nomacro bltz $6,$L739 move $8,$0 .set macro .set reorder$L210: addiu $7,$7,1 sra $3,$7,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$7,0x7 sll $4,$4,$3 .set noreorder .set nomacro bgez $4,$L210 addiu $8,$8,1 .set macro .set reorder li $5,2147418112 # 0x7fff0000 ori $2,$5,0xfffd slt $2,$2,$8 sll $4,$4,1 .set noreorder .set nomacro beq $2,$0,$L740 addiu $3,$7,1 .set macro .set reorder ori $2,$5,0xfffe beq $8,$2,$L215 .set noreorder .set nomacro j $L200 li $11,-1 # 0xffffffffffffffff .set macro .set reorder$L335: lw $4,104($sp) lw $8,96($sp) move $2,$4 sw $4,40($sp) .set noreorder .set nomacro j $L176 sw $0,0($8) .set macro .set reorder$L337: lw $9,8($20) s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$6,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$6,$2 .set noreorder .set nomacro bne $2,$0,$L564 srl $3,$6,16 .set macro .set reorder move $3,$6 move $4,$0$L566: andi $2,$3,0xff00 .set noreorder .set nomacro beq $2,$0,$L785 addiu $2,$15,%lo(ff_log2_tab) .set macro .set reorder srl $3,$3,8 addiu $4,$4,8$L785: addu $2,$3,$2 lbu $3,0($2) addu $5,$4,$3 slt $2,$5,21 .set noreorder .set nomacro beq $2,$0,$L569 li $3,30 # 0x1e .set macro .set reorder .set noreorder .set nomacro bltz $6,$L741 move $7,$0 .set macro .set reorder$L574: addiu $9,$9,1 s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$4,$4,$3 .set noreorder .set nomacro bgez $4,$L574 addiu $7,$7,1 .set macro .set reorder li $5,2147418112 # 0x7fff0000 ori $2,$5,0xfffd slt $2,$2,$7 sll $4,$4,1 .set noreorder .set nomacro beq $2,$0,$L742 addiu $3,$9,1 .set macro .set reorder ori $2,$5,0xfffe beq $7,$2,$L579 li $2,-1 # 0xffffffffffffffff$L573: sw $2,16508($18)$L315: lw $3,36($sp)$L788: lw $4,92($sp) lw $8,96($sp) subu $2,$3,$4 sw $2,0($8) lw $3,8($20) .set noreorder .set nomacro bltz $3,$L743 move $2,$3 .set macro .set reorder$L625: sra $2,$2,3 sll $2,$2,3 subu $2,$3,$2 sw $2,16528($18) lw $3,8($20) slt $2,$3,0 addiu $4,$3,7 movn $3,$4,$2 sra $7,$3,3 lw $3,104($sp) slt $2,$3,$7 .set noreorder .set nomacro bne $2,$0,$L638 lw $8,104($sp) .set macro .set reorder lw $3,100($18) .set noreorder .set nomacro beq $3,$0,$L639 subu $6,$3,$7 .set macro .set reorder lw $2,104($18) addu $7,$2,$7 lw $2,40($sp) sw $6,100($18) .set noreorder .set nomacro j $L176 sw $7,104($18) .set macro .set reorder$L334: li $2,8 # 0x8 .set noreorder .set nomacro beq $8,$2,$L744 lw $12,16504($18) .set macro .set reorder lw $9,8($20) s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$6,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$6,$2 .set noreorder .set nomacro bne $2,$0,$L343 srl $3,$6,16 .set macro .set reorder move $3,$6 move $4,$0$L345: andi $2,$3,0xff00 .set noreorder .set nomacro beq $2,$0,$L786 addiu $2,$15,%lo(ff_log2_tab) .set macro .set reorder srl $3,$3,8 addiu $4,$4,8$L786: addu $2,$3,$2 lbu $3,0($2) addu $5,$4,$3 slt $2,$5,21 .set noreorder .set nomacro beq $2,$0,$L348 li $3,30 # 0x1e .set macro .set reorder .set noreorder .set nomacro bltz $6,$L745 sll $4,$6,1 .set macro .set reorder move $11,$0$L353: addiu $9,$9,1 s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$4,$4,$3 .set noreorder .set nomacro bgez $4,$L353 addiu $11,$11,1 .set macro .set reorder li $5,2147418112 # 0x7fff0000 ori $2,$5,0xfffd slt $2,$2,$11 sll $4,$4,1 .set noreorder .set nomacro beq $2,$0,$L746 addiu $3,$9,1 .set macro .set reorder ori $2,$5,0xfffe .set noreorder .set nomacro beq $11,$2,$L358 addiu $11,$4,1 .set macro .set reorder li $11,-1 # 0xffffffffffffffff$L352: lw $3,16500($18) addiu $2,$11,-1 movz $11,$2,$3$L342: lw $9,16512($18) .set noreorder .set nomacro bne $9,$0,$L361 sll $16,$12,2 .set macro .set reorder addu $2,$16,$18 lw $3,64($2) lw $17,0($3)$L363: sltu $2,$8,9 .set noreorder .set nomacro beq $2,$0,$L371 lui $2,%hi($L378) .set macro .set reorder addiu $2,$2,%lo($L378) addu $2,$7,$2 lw $3,0($2) j $3 .rdata .align 2 .align 2$L378: .word $L372 .word $L373 .word $L374 .word $L375 .word $L371 .word $L371 .word $L371 .word $L376 .word $L377 .section .text.shorten_decode_frame$L338: lw $9,8($20) s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$6,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$6,$2 .set noreorder .set nomacro bne $2,$0,$L532 srl $3,$6,16 .set macro .set reorder move $3,$6 move $4,$0$L534: andi $2,$3,0xff00 .set noreorder .set nomacro beq $2,$0,$L787 addiu $2,$15,%lo(ff_log2_tab) .set macro .set reorder srl $3,$3,8 addiu $4,$4,8$L787: addu $2,$3,$2 lbu $3,0($2) addu $5,$4,$3 slt $2,$5,21 .set noreorder .set nomacro beq $2,$0,$L537 li $3,30 # 0x1e .set macro .set reorder .set noreorder .set nomacro bltz $6,$L747 move $7,$0 .set macro .set reorder$L542: addiu $9,$9,1 s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$4,$4,$3 .set noreorder .set nomacro bgez $4,$L542 addiu $7,$7,1 .set macro .set reorder li $5,2147418112 # 0x7fff0000 ori $2,$5,0xfffd slt $2,$2,$7 sll $4,$4,1 .set noreorder .set nomacro beq $2,$0,$L748 addiu $3,$9,1 .set macro .set reorder ori $2,$5,0xfffe .set noreorder .set nomacro beq $7,$2,$L547 addiu $8,$4,1 .set macro .set reorder li $8,-1 # 0xffffffffffffffff$L722: addiu $8,$8,-1 li $2,-1 # 0xffffffffffffffff .set noreorder .set nomacro beq $8,$2,$L788 lw $3,36($sp) .set macro .set reorder lw $9,8($20) s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) lbu $4,2($3) sll $2,$2,24 sll $5,$5,16 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$4,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$4,$2 .set noreorder .set nomacro bne $2,$0,$L550 srl $3,$4,16 .set macro .set reorder move $3,$4 move $5,$0$L552: andi $2,$3,0xff00 .set noreorder .set nomacro beq $2,$0,$L789 addiu $2,$15,%lo(ff_log2_tab) .set macro .set reorder srl $3,$3,8 addiu $5,$5,8$L789: addu $2,$3,$2 lbu $3,0($2) addu $3,$5,$3 slt $2,$3,21 .set noreorder .set nomacro beq $2,$0,$L555 li $2,8 # 0x8 .set macro .set reorder .set noreorder .set nomacro bltz $4,$L749 move $7,$0 .set macro .set reorder$L559: addiu $9,$9,1 sra $4,$9,3 addu $4,$10,$4 lbu $3,0($4) lbu $5,1($4) lbu $6,3($4) lbu $2,2($4) sll $3,$3,24 sll $5,$5,16 or $3,$3,$5 or $3,$3,$6 sll $2,$2,8 or $2,$2,$3 andi $4,$9,0x7 sll $2,$2,$4 .set noreorder .set nomacro bgez $2,$L559 addiu $7,$7,1 .set macro .set reorder li $4,2147418112 # 0x7fff0000 ori $2,$4,0xfffd slt $2,$2,$7 .set noreorder .set nomacro beq $2,$0,$L562 addiu $3,$9,1 .set macro .set reorder ori $2,$4,0xfffe bne $7,$2,$L722 .set noreorder .set nomacro j $L722 sw $3,8($20) .set macro .set reorder$L336: lw $5,16524($18) li $2,-65536 # 0xffffffffffff0000 and $2,$5,$2 bne $2,$0,$L581 move $4,$0$L583: andi $2,$5,0xff00 beq $2,$0,$L584 srl $5,$5,8 addiu $4,$4,8$L584: addiu $2,$15,%lo(ff_log2_tab) lw $3,16500($18) addu $2,$5,$2 .set noreorder .set nomacro bne $3,$0,$L586 lbu $2,0($2) .set macro .set reorder lw $9,8($20) addu $11,$4,$2$L588: sra $3,$9,3 addu $3,$10,$3 lbu $2,0($3) lbu $5,1($3) lbu $6,3($3) sll $5,$5,16 lbu $4,2($3) sll $2,$2,24 or $2,$2,$5 or $2,$2,$6 sll $4,$4,8 or $4,$4,$2 andi $3,$9,0x7 sll $5,$4,$3 li $2,-65536 # 0xffffffffffff0000 and $2,$5,$2 .set noreorder .set nomacro bne $2,$0,$L605 move $7,$9 .set macro .set reorder move $3,$5 move $4,$0$L607: andi $2,$3,0xff00
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-